Are old lighters worth anything?

Lighters come in all sizes, colours and materials. Obviously, the modern plastic ones aren't worth anything, but the value of the antique lighters can vary because of the materials that are used. A lighter made of gold or silver is generally worth much more than one made of more common materials.

In this way, what is the most expensive lighter in the world?

The venerable Parisian luxury goods firm of S.T. Dupont has come out with the world's most expensive lighter priced at $79,000. The Ligne 2 Champagne lighter, part of Dupont's Prestige Collection, is made of solid 18-carat white gold embellished with 468 brilliant-cut diamonds.

How long does a Bic lighter last?

Full sized Bic lighters are supposed to burn for an hour, though not continuously. Mini Bic lighters contain less fuel and generally burn for around twenty minutes. However, if you light it and keep it lit, your lighter has around ten minutes before the top starts to deform from the heat.

What makes the spark in a lighter?

A spark is created by striking metal against a flint, or by pressing a button that compresses a piezoelectric crystal (piezo ignition), generating an electric arc. In naphtha lighters, the liquid is sufficiently volatile, and flammable vapour is present as soon as the top of the lighter is opened.

Are Dunhill lighters valuable?

Dunhill is the most popular and desirable name for collectors. Lighter collectors should look for inset watches or concealed features such as compacts. Early lighters were powered by naphtha, a petroleum mixture, and these are more desirable than the butane gas lighters, that were introduced in the late 1940s.

Are all Zippos windproof?

Zippos are classified as windproof lighters, and are are able to remain lighted in almost any wind situation. Additionally, Zippo lighters are known for the lifetime guaranty they carry: if a Zippo breaks down, no matter how old, the company will replace or repair the lighter for free.

When should I trim my Zippo Wick?

Tip: This should be performed once or twice a year. Each wick is almost four (4) inches in length, so after 2-3 trimmings you'll need to replace the wick. The wick should be changed if the lighter does not light properly or if the ignition process has to be repeated multiple times.

Can you overfill a Zippo?

Tip: Do not overfill. If overfilled, the lighter will leak fuel. Avoid getting the fluid on your skin, as it is a skin irritant. If contact with skin does occur, wash the affected areas promptly with mild soap and water.
